Types of Secure Door Locks

Selecting the best lock for your doors can be intimidating due to the range of options available. Below is a thorough look at the most typical kinds of secure door locks:

1. Deadbolt Locks

Deadbolt locks are among the most popular types of locks. They are understood for their strength and reliability. Deadbolts come in 2 main variations:

  • Single Cylinder Deadbolt: Operated with a secret on the outside and a thumb turn on the within.
  • Double Cylinder Deadbolt: Requires a key for both sides, using extra security however can pose threats in an emergency.
FeatureSingle Cylinder DeadboltDouble Cylinder Deadbolt
Security LevelModerateHigh
Fire escapeEasy accessNeeds crucial for exit
Use CaseResidentialAreas with glass doors

2. Smart Locks

Smart locks use innovative functions that conventional locks can not. They can be controlled via smart device apps or suitable smart home systems. Key functions include:

  • Keyless Entry: Many smart locks permit entry through a mobile phone or numerical code.
  • Remote Access: Users can lock or unlock doors from anywhere.
  • Audit Trails: Monitor who enters and exits your home.

3. Keypad Locks

Keypad locks combine traditional locking systems with modern innovation. They allow users to get in a code to acquire entry, eliminating the requirement for keys. Benefits consist of:

  • No Lost Keys: Users can quickly change codes if necessary.
  • Hassle-free for Temporary Access: Useful for visitors or service personnel.

4. Mortise Locks

Mortise locks are more robust than basic deadbolts and are typically discovered in commercial settings. They are set up within the door itself, offering a greater level of security. Secret functions consist of:

  • Enhanced Durability: Mortise locks are less susceptible to forced entry.
  • Multiple Functions: Often included extra security features such as a deadbolt.

5. Rim Locks

Rim locks mount on the surface area of the door. They are more visible however can supply an extra layer of security when combined with locks set up within the door itself.

Considerations for Choosing Secure Door Locks

When choosing a secure door lock, several aspects must be thought about to guarantee optimum security and benefit. Here are some key points:

  • Material Quality: Look for locks made of strong products such as hardened steel or brass.
  • Security Ratings: Consult industry certifications such as ASTM or BHMA to gauge a lock's strength and dependability.
  • Installation Quality: A poorly installed lock is less secure, regardless of its quality.
  • Compatibility: Ensure that the lock type matches your door's existing features.
  • Lifestyle Needs: Consider how the usability of the lock aligns with your lifestyle or special needs, particularly in cases of elderly homeowners or kids.

FAQs About Secure Door Locks

What are the best door locks for houses?

For apartment or condos, a great alternative is a grade 1 deadbolt for exterior doors paired with a smart lock for added benefit.

How often should I change my door locks?

Door locks should typically be altered when moving into a new residential or commercial property, after a burglary, or every 3 to 5 years for worn-out mechanisms.

Are smart locks worth the financial investment?

Smart locks supply benefit and improved security functions, making them a valuable investment, particularly for busy families and tech-savvy homeowners.

Can I set up a door lock myself?

Numerous door locks include installation sets and guidelines for DIY installation. Nevertheless, for more complicated locks, hiring a professional locksmith professional is a good idea for right placement and optimum security.
